EPSON Stylus Photo 890/1280/1290
4.
Move the Carriage to the center of the printer mechanism. Put the PG adjustment
tool right on the rightmost rib of Paper Guide Front.

To move the Carriage Unit, pull the timing belt with your hand.
C A U T I O N
n
Be careful not to damage the CR scale (linear encoder).
5.
Set the PG Lever to the rear side (the "+" position).
6.
Move the Carriage to right until it covers the right C part of the PG adjustment
tool. Make sure the right edge of the printhead frame is placed right above the C
part of the PG adjustment tool.
Set the PG Lever to the front side (the "0" position).
Table 5-4. Carriage on PG Adjustment Tool
7.
Set the Right Parallel Adjustment Bushing forward. By moving the bushing to the
back one notch at a time, find the position where the printhead touches the PG
adjustment tool. From the touching point, move the bushing forward (Wider PG
direction) by one notch.
